What is a QEP?

The Quality Enhancement Plan (QEP) is a major university wide project developed as part of the accreditation process and must meet certain SACSCOC requirements. According to the SACSCOC requirements, the QEP should reflect the university's mission statement, focus on issues important to student learning, be documented through institutional data, be developed on broad-based input, be effectively evaluated, and result in enhanced student learning.
